Transaction e5e8dc32393ae91afdb076234d4095c4ffac7d454753df82f7b3938698820a48
1 Input
1 Output
-
e5e8dc32393ae91afdb076234d4095c4ffac7d454753df82f7b3938698820a48:0
- value
- 250246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2b8beaca838c62ba6ae33108d99590616454de0 OP_EQUAL
- address
- 3GXQhv4AvA4PzuibwUbi63utJ39vuEbvBa